Chateau Meyney Cru Bourgeois Superieur St-Estephe
Château Meyney is located in St.Estèphe and is owned by Dmes. Cordier. The 49 ha property produces on average 30,000 cases per year. Located in the east of the St.Estèphe appellation, next to Château Montrose, Meyney has a similar climate to that enjoyed by the Médoc: maritime, with the Gironde estuary and the Bay of Biscay combining to act as a climate regulator and the coastal pine forests sheltering the vines from the westerly and north-westerly winds. Meyney's vineyards lie on clay-gravel soils. Vinification includes 15 months' wood ageing, 30% new oak. (12 x 75 cl)

Chateau Meyney Cru Bourgeois Superieur Saint Estephe
Overlooking the Gironde estuary this wine is a blend of 70% Cabernet Sauvignon, 20% Merlot, 10% Cabernet Franc. One of the oldest estates in the Médoc. In 1662 it was a convent which the archives refer to as the Convent des Feuilles or the Pricure des Couleys. Today the estate stretches over a series of hillocks and the nearness of the river, flowing so close to the first rows of vines, gives the landscape a majestic air. The estate belonged to the same family for several generations, until Mr. Daniel Cordier became the owner in 1919, and still remains under Domaines Cordier today. The wine is fermented in glass lined vats and Clarified with egg whites. The wine is aged in large oak casks for the first year and barrel aged the second year. A big wine with good fruit and excellent aging potential. A thick, delicious wine that is rich with berry, vanilla, and meat Aromas of wet earth, mineral and stone. Very pleasant to taste.
